Renault Icons sale set for December

As part of its move to scale down its car collection, Renault is selling off some of its heritage cars.

The Renault Icons sale, run by Artcurial, will take place on Friday 7 December at Flins-sur-Seine, which will also become the permanent home of a forthcoming Renault museum that will be open to the public.

One hundred vehicles will be included in the sale, which will see duplicates go under the hammer.

Among the lots are 20 Formula 1 cars, prototypes, and road cars, plus there will be 100 items of memorabilia including F1 engines, design models, and wind tunnel models.

None of the cars being sold has ever come to market before, which will see a 1978 Renault Alpine A442 , 1982 F1 RE 30-B9 and 40-04, and F1 Lotus 95 T offered for sale.
